In the heart of Sorrento, the romantic botanical suites of Domus Florum are located within the park of Villa Zagara, the largest garden in the city center, which also inspired the decor of the beautiful rooms.
Domus Florum Sorrento, opening in the summer of 2025, is located within Villa Zagara, a historic residence immersed in the vibrant soul of its botanical gardens, where nature is the true protagonist and celebrated in every detail.
Owned by the Acampora-Apreda family since 1978, Villa Zagara Sorrento owes its name to the citrus flowers of the same name, which, according to classical mythology, were given as gifts to the goddesses for their wedding rites.

And it is precisely to classical myths that the marvelous villa overlooking the seaside village of Marina Grande owes its origins. Agrippa, the famous Roman general who defeated Cleopatra and Antony, lived there in the summer of the 1st century BC with his second wife Julia, daughter of Caesar Octavian. He, in fact, built the outdoor nympheum that currently serves as the romantic swimming pool at Villa Zagara Sorrento, also accessible to guests of the Domus.

The Secret
Not far from Domus Florum is the Villa Zagara balsamic vinegar factory (visits by appointment), the only one in Southern Italy, reminiscent of a period salon, where Nino Apreda refines his extraordinary balsamic vinegars. Guests of Domus Florum can book tastings of both the balsamic vinegar and the award-winning olive oil produced by the family from their olive groves.
